Did you contact the insurer prior to going through the FOS? I am thinking what happens if they come back to me saying it wasn't actually them that sold me the insurance?
How long did yours take?
Yes I did as a normal reclaiming procedure, the chances are they will come back to say they were not responsible, but the FOS are trying to make them responsible as well, and these would have been governed, and of course many have still been successful with going the insurer direction.
But at least you will not be turned away from the FOS.
When I requested for as copy of my policy, it arrived about 10 days or so after, then I emailed as well has sent an hardcopy in the post to the Insurer, who were Hamilton, yet through Aviva like yourself, they got back within a few days.
I sent all my details with a complaints form to the FOS, with the letter from Hamilton (copy), in October 09, they have kept me updated though to let me know it will be passed on to an adjudicator in due course.;)The one and only "Dizzy Di"0
